Why are the “Little Things” Important for Mental Health?

It’s easy to overlook the small moments that can bring us joy. However, here’s why it is essential to our wellness:

Enhances Positive Emotions: Appreciating little things in life can boost our positive emotions, such as happiness, gratitude and sense of peace. 

Cultivates Mindfulness: Paying attention to the little things in life requires us to be present in the moment and practice mindfulness. This state of awareness has been shown to reduce stress, improve mental clarity, and enhance overall wellbeing.

Builds Resilience: Finding joy in our day to day can help us develop a resilient mindset by shifting our focus from what we lack to what we have. This positive perspective can help us cope better with challenges and setbacks, contributing to better mental resilience.

Fosters Gratitude: Practicing gratitude can shift our mindset from a mindset of scarcity to abundance. Gratitude has been linked to increased happiness, improved relationships, and enhanced mental well-being.

Fort Point Beer Company – If you haven’t checked out Fort Point Beer Company yet, you’re missing out on a truly unique craft beer experience. Founded in 2014 by brothers Tyler and Justin Catalana, Fort Point is all about creating approachable, flavorful beers that showcase the spirit and flavors of San Francisco. Here are a few reasons to visit…

  • Their commitment to using local, seasonal ingredients ensures that every beer is packed with fresh, delicious flavor.
  • The Catalana brothers are passionate about giving back to the San Francisco community, and their partnerships with local organizations like the Golden Gate National Parks Conservancy are a testament to their dedication.
  • With three locations across San Francisco, there’s always a Fort Point Beer Company nearby when you’re in the mood for a great brew.

Ras Al Khor Wildlife Sanctuary

Located in the heart of Dubai, Ras Al Khor Wildlife Sanctuary is a hidden gem for nature lovers. This sanctuary is home to over 20,000 birds, including flamingos, herons, and eagles. It is free to visit and offers guided tours by foot or by boat – a great way to discover the different species of birds and wildlife. Black Palace Beach

Dubai is home to some of the most beautiful beaches in the world, and Black Palace Beach is one of the best. This secluded beach is located in the Al Sufouh area and is a favorite spot for people seeking a peaceful escape from the city.

Black Palace Beach is known for its clear waters and pristine sands, making it an ideal spot for swimming, sunbathing, and relaxing. Take a stroll along the beach and enjoy the stunning views of the Dubai skyline but be warned – there aren’t many amenities here so make sure to come prepared.

The Farm

The Farm is a unique destination in Dubai, offering visitors a taste of the countryside in the heart of the city. It is located in Al Barari, in the midst of a lush green oasis right in the middle of the desert. The Farm features a farm-to-table restaurant, an organic vegetable garden, and a nursery selling a variety of plants. During your visit, take a leisurely walk through the garden, sample fresh produce and admire the beautiful flowers. The restaurant at The Farm serves delicious meals made with locally sourced ingredients, providing you with a unique dining experience.
